Severe Muscle Pain, Difficulty In Movement. What Could Be This?
Good morning, For two weeks I have had severe deep muscle pain under my rt.buttock spreading down the back of my thigh,almost as far as my knee.It is agony getting into or standing up from a sitting position and have to support myself holding onto something to support myself.I can no longer lean forward or stoop to pick something up.
Please could you suggest what the problem is.I do not partake in any sports.
There are big group of muscles in that area. Any muscle spasm or injury is most likely. Sacroiliitis is one condition which will present like this. Lastly sciatica due to radiating nature of the pain. Consult an orthopedician of management.
